We haven’t received any updates about QuickBooks Self-Employed being able to categorize transactions automatically. It’s possible that the Rules feature in the program is causing this to happen.


Once you’ve enabled it, QBSE will assign your downloaded bank entries right-away to a specific payee or categories. Let’s double-check this setting on your account, then edit or delete it if necessary.

 

Here's how:

  1. Go to the Gear icon at the top, select Rules.
  2. Look for the rule you need to review.
  3. Pick Edit to modify it.
  4. Otherwise, click the Edit drop-down and choose Delete.

Please note that if you delete a rule, it won't be applied going forward. However, it also does not erase anything that's been applied so far.

Thanks for getting back to us about the transactions tagged as Predicted in QuickBooks Self-Employed.

 

QuickBooks Self-Employed recently launched this new feature about predicting transactions. Right now, it's on beta testing and the option to disable this aspect is not yet available.
